+ OpenSSL/CreateKey.hs view
@@ -0,0 +1,76 @@+{-# LANGUAGE ForeignFunctionInterface #-}+module OpenSSL.CreateKey(createKey, promptPassword, readKeyPair, readCertificate) where++import Control.Monad+import Data.Time+import Foreign.C+import OpenSSL.EVP.Cipher+import OpenSSL.EVP.PKey+import OpenSSL.PEM+import OpenSSL.RSA+import OpenSSL.X509+import System.Directory+import System.IO+import System.Posix++createKey :: String            -- ^ Key name+          -> FilePath          -- ^ Base filepath+          -> Maybe SomeKeyPair -- ^ Key for signing the certificate, otherwise self-signed+          -> PemPasswordSupply -- ^ Method for writing private key file+          -> IO (X509, SomeKeyPair)+createKey name bfp mkey gk = do+    cfile <- return (bfp++".public.cert")+    sfile <- return (bfp++".secret.key")+    e1 <- doesFileExist cfile+    e2 <- doesFileExist sfile+    when (e1 || e2) $ fail "Key exists already!"+    let list = [("CN",name)]+    pkey  <- generateRSAKey 2048 65537 Nothing+    cert  <- newX509+    setVersion cert 2+    setSerialNumber cert 1+    setIssuerName  cert list+    setSubjectName cert list+    setNotBefore cert =<< liftM (addUTCTime (-1)) getCurrentTime+    setNotAfter  cert =<< liftM (addUTCTime (365 * 24 * 60 * 60)) getCurrentTime+    setPublicKey cert pkey+    case mkey of+      Nothing -> signX509 cert pkey Nothing+      Just kp -> signX509 cert kp   Nothing+    Just ciph <- getCipherByName "AES256"+    sdata <- writePKCS8PrivateKey pkey (Just (ciph, gk))+    cdata <- writeX509 cert+    writeFile sfile sdata+    setFileMode sfile 0o400+    writeFile cfile cdata+    setFileMode cfile 0o400+    return (cert, fromKeyPair pkey)++-- | Read Key+readKeyPair :: FilePath -> PemPasswordSupply -> IO (X509, SomeKeyPair)+readKeyPair fp pps = do+  cfile <- return (fp++".public.cert")+  sfile <- return (fp++".secret.key")+  mcert <- readX509 =<< readFile cfile+  key <- (flip readPrivateKey pps =<< readFile sfile)+  return (mcert, key)++readCertificate :: FilePath -> IO X509+readCertificate fp = do+  readX509 =<< readFile (fp++".public.cert")++promptPassword :: PemPasswordSupply+promptPassword = PwCallback ppc++ppc :: Int -> PemPasswordRWState -> IO [Char]+ppc mlen PwRead = take mlen `fmap` getPass "Password: "+ppc mlen PwWrite= take mlen `fmap` loop+    where loop = do c1 <- getPass "Password: "+                    c2 <- getPass "Confirm password: "+                    if (c1 == c2) then return c1 else do+                    hPutStrLn stderr "Passwords do not match!"+                    loop+getPass :: String -> IO String+getPass p = withCString p (\cs -> peekCString =<< getpass cs)+foreign import ccall safe getpass :: CString -> IO CString+
